Developing Ergonomic Seating Solutions

When it comes to designing ergonomic seating solutions, precision engineering is crucial. It requires a deep understanding of human anatomy and the ability to translate that knowledge into the physical design of a chair or seat. This process involves a combination of technology, creativity, and a keen eye for detail.

Engineers working on seating design must consider factors such as posture, body support, and comfort. They use advanced CAD software to create 3D models of their designs, allowing them to analyze and modify the geometry to achieve the perfect balance between aesthetics and functionality.

Materials Selection and Testing

Another important aspect of precision engineering in seating design is the selection and testing of materials. The choice of materials has a significant impact on the performance and durability of the final product. Engineers must carefully evaluate a wide range of materials, considering factors such as strength, flexibility, weight, and environmental impact.

Advanced material testing techniques, including stress analysis and fatigue testing, are used to ensure that the selected materials can withstand the demands of everyday use. This process is essential in creating seating solutions that are not only comfortable but also reliable and long-lasting.

Integration of Technology

The integration of technology into seating design has revolutionized the way engineers approach their work. Innovative features such as adjustable lumbar support, heating and cooling systems, and dynamic body sensors have become increasingly common in modern seating solutions.

Engineers must carefully integrate these technological features into their designs, ensuring seamless functionality and user-friendly interfaces. This requires a deep understanding of electronics and software, as well as a strong focus on user experience and human-centered design principles.

Collaboration with Ergonomics Experts

Developing seating solutions that prioritize user comfort and health requires close collaboration with ergonomics experts. These professionals provide valuable insights into human body mechanics, helping engineers to optimize their designs for maximum comfort and support.

By working closely with ergonomics experts, engineers can refine their designs to minimize the risk of musculoskeletal disorders and improve overall user well-being. This collaborative approach is essential in creating seating solutions that truly prioritize the needs of the end user.
